2001KO69      Nucl.Sci.Eng. 139, 273 (2001)

K.Kobayashi, S.Yamamoto, S.Lee, H.-J.Cho, H.Yamana, H.Moriyama, Y.Fujita, T.Mitsugashira

Measurement of Neutron-Induced Fission Cross Sections of 229Th and 231Pa using Linac-Driven Lead Slowing-Down Spectrometer

NUCLEAR REACTIONS 229Th, 231Pa(n, F), E < 10 keV; measured fission σ. Comparison with previous results.

2000TS08      J.Nucl.Sci.Technol.(Tokyo) 37, 941 (2000)

C.Tsuchiya, Y.Nakagome, H.Yamana, H.Moriyama, K.Nishio, I.Kanno, K.Shin, I.Kimura

Simultaneous Measurement of Prompt Neutrons and Fission Fragments for 239Pu(nth, f)

NUCLEAR REACTIONS 239Pu(n, F), E=thermal; measured prompt neutrons energy, multiplicity, fission fragment mass distributions, kinetic energy, (fragment)(neutron)-coin. Comparison with model predictions.

1982NI04      Bull.Inst.Chem.Res., Kyoto Univ. 60, 132 (1982)

T.Nishi, I.Fujiwara, N.Imanishi, H.Moriyama, K.Otozai, R.Arakawa, T.Saito, T.Tsuneyoshi, N.Takahashi, S.Iwata, S.Hayashi, S.Shibata, H.Kudo, K.Yoshida

Negative Pion Induced Reactions in Bismuth at 0.87 GeV

NUCLEAR REACTIONS 209Bi(π-, X), (π-, F), E=0.87 GeV; measured binary fission, spallation production σ for 206,205,204,203,201Bi, 204m,203,201,200,199,198,195Pb, 202,200,199,198m,198,194mTl, 203,199m,195m,195,193mHg, 199Au, 198m,198,196,194,193Au, 165Tm, 161,160Er, 160mHo, 157,155,152Dy, 152Tb, 139mNd, 113Ag, 99Mo, 91Sr. Activation technique.


1981NI03      Nucl.Phys. A352, 461 (1981)

T.Nishi, I.Fujiwara, N.Imanishi, H.Moriyama, K.Otozai, R.Arakawa, S.Saito, T.Tsuneyoshi, N.Takahashi, S.Iwata, S.Hayashi, S.Shibata, H.Kudo, K.Yoshida

Cross Sections of Negative-Pion-Induced Reactions in 9Be, 12C and 19F Nuclei Between 0.4 and 1.9 GeV

NUCLEAR REACTIONS 12C, 19F(π-, π-n), 12C, 9Be(π-, πn), (π-, πX), E=0.4-1.9 GeV; measured production σ(E) for 11C, 18F, 8B, 8Li, 6He; deduced reaction mechanism, T=1/2, 3/2 isobar resonances. Activation technique.
